Bar chart wrong using color saturation

All bar charts appear to be wrong in this case; X axis with numbers from negative to positive, X axis 'start' setup e.g. on '-1' (with data present less than -1).  All fine, until you use color saturation. Seems that the coloring loop doesn't take the 'start' into account, mixing up the indexing of the bars... Resulting in wrong X labels etc.
